Peak Energy is a leading renewable energy platform committed to developing solar, wind, and battery projects across Asia. As energy demand rises, we are committed to delivering reliable renewable energy solutions that empower businesses and economies to reduce their carbon footprint and achieve their sustainability goals. Backed by Stonepeak Infrastructure Partners, with over USD 72+ billion in assets under management, Peak Energy brings a wealth of expertise to build some of the largest renewable projects in Korea, Japan, Taiwan and Southeast Asia (including Singapore). We have a mandate to invest ~USD2Bn of capex within the next 5 to 7 years, through two different sectors: Utility Scale projects and Distributed Generation.
